This release folder contains the public-facing files for one benchmark cell: complex market, covariance_probit DGP, endogeneity on, seed 001.
Files
public/products_public.csv: public SKU metadata, family-level text, structured attributes, and image specs.public/transactions_train_public.csv: positive-sales (units>0) SKU-store-week transaction rows with anonymized store IDs and public supply-cost proxy. Stores carry a permanent subset of the 40-SKU catalog; carriage is inferable from row presence (>=1 positive train-window row) but is NOT released as an explicit matrix.public/counterfactual_context_public.csv: price-policy intervention context.
Hidden DGP parameters, store covariates, calibration quantities, and counterfactual truth are intentionally outside this public release folder.
covariance_probit cells use a two-stage structural model: (1) a purchase-incidence model sets the total category demand per (store, week) via market_size_st = M_0 * Total_Households[s] * seasonality_t * exp(rho*CV_st) * exp(lambda*G_mt + eps), where CV_st = log sum_j exp(Vbar_jst) is the category value (inclusive value of the same brand-choice utilities; Bucklin & Gupta 1992), calibrated against total IRI units; (2) conditional choice is J-only over the J inside products (no outside option). The exogenous inputs public/households_public.csv and public/seasonality_index_public.csv are released; the realized market-size proxy is retired (option A) so the hidden price response cannot be divided out.
Complex cells include rendered package-style PNG images under public/images/.
